Snazzy Exterior

 

Choose from three trims — the SE, SEL, and Denim — to find the perfect Venue to fit your lifestyle. With a 99.2-inch wheelbase, the Venue is ideal for city driving and parking in tight spaces. You’ll find 15-inch alloy wheels on the SE trim and 17-inch alloy wheels on the SEL and Denim trims. The familiar Hyundai grille graces the front of the vehicle, and from the hood to the rear hatch, the Venue has a streamlined silhouette.

 

Choose from seven colors for your SE and SEL trims. The stylish Denim comes exclusively in denim blue with a contrasting white roof and accents on the fender. If you want a sunroof on your Venue, choose the SEL trim.

 

Snappy Performance

 

You’ll enjoy zipping around town with the solid performance the Venue puts out. All trims have a 1.6-liter four-cylinder engine under the hood that produces 121 horsepower and 113 pounds-feet of torque. New this year, the Venue pairs with a continuously variable transmission, and all trims come with front-wheel drive.

 

Roomy Interior

Two rows of seats fit five people comfortably, with an overall passenger volume of 91.9 cubic feet. The Venue also boasts plenty of space for groceries and luggage. Using the 60/40 split-folding rear seats, you get 19 cubic feet of cargo space, and with the back seat folded flat, you get 32 cubic feet. For flexible storage options, the cargo area has a dual-level floor with a privacy cover.

Cloth seats provide for a comfortable ride. When you choose the SEL or Denim trim, however, you get a leather-wrapped steering wheel and shift knob as well as leatherette upholstery. Heated front seats and passive entry with push-button start come standard on the Denim trim and are available on the SE and SEL.

 

Innovative Technology

 

You’ll enjoy a suite of modern tech features inside the Venue’s cabin. The infotainment system features an 8-inch touch screen with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to integration. Hyundai’s Blue Link connected car system is new for 2021 and allows you to sync your Amazon Alexa and Google-supported devices to control select features remotely. The Venue also comes with dual USB ports,

Bluetooth, and available SiriusXM satellite radio.

 

Safety and Driver-Assist Features

 

Hyundai prides itself on equipping its vehicles with plenty of safety and driver-assist features. The Venue comes with the automaker’s SmartSense system of safety features that includes forward-collision warning with automatic emergency braking, lane-keeping assist, driver attention warning, blind-spot warning with rear cross-traffic alert, and automatic high-beam headlights.
